Daily per capita protein supply in Bahrain
Bahrain: Daily per capita protein supply was 99.79 grams of protein per day per capita in 2023. ▼ Falling
Daily per capita protein supply in Bahrain, 2019–2023
Source: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ations (2025) – processed by Our World in Data. Measured in grams of protein per day per capita.
Analysis
Bahrain recorded 99.79 grams of protein per day per capita for daily per capita protein supply in 2023. That is the lowest value across all 5 years on record.
The figure is down 7.8% on the previous year and down 8.7% over five years.
Bahrain ranks 73rd of 191 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

About this data
Quantity that is available for consumption at the end of the supply chain. It does not account for consumer waste, so the quantity that is actually consumed may be lower. This is the total of all agricultural produce, both crops and livestock.
